4-Day Family-Friendly Itinerary in Goa

Sunday, October 22: Beach Bliss

Start your trip by immersing yourself in the serene atmosphere of Calangute Beach. In the morning, enjoy a leisurely walk along the sandy shore, marveling at the crystal-clear waters and golden sun. Afterward, head to Baga Beach for some family fun in the afternoon. Try water sports like jet skiing or parasailing, or simply relax on the beach. As the sun sets, make your way to Anjuna Flea Market, known for its vibrant atmosphere and local handicrafts.

  • Calangute Beach: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Baga Beach: Water sports cost around ₹500-₹1000 per activity, 3-4 hours
  • Anjuna Flea Market: Free, 2-3 hours
Monday, October 23: Cultural Exploration

Start your day with a visit to the historic Fort Aguada. Explore the well-preserved fort and enjoy panoramic views of the Arabian Sea. In the afternoon, head to the charming Fontainhas neighborhood in Panjim, known for its colorful Portuguese-style houses. Take a leisurely stroll through the narrow streets, admiring the architecture and stopping by local art galleries. Wrap up the day with a visit to the Goa Science Centre, an interactive museum perfect for both kids and adults.

  • Fort Aguada: ₹10 per person, 2-3 hours
  • Fontainhas: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Goa Science Centre: ₹20 per person, 2-3 hours
Restaurants
  • For breakfast, head to Cafe Alchemia which offers a cozy atmosphere and a variety of breakfast options. Average cost for a meal is about ₹200 per person.
  • For lunch, try Vinayak Family Restaurant located in Panjim, serving delicious Goan and North Indian cuisine. Average cost for a meal is about ₹300 per person.
  • For dinner, check out Mum's Kitchen, a popular restaurant in Panjim known for its authentic Goan dishes. Average cost for a meal is about ₹500 per person.
Tuesday, October 24: Wildlife Adventure

Embark on a thrilling wildlife adventure at the Bhagwan Mahavir Wildlife Sanctuary and Mollem National Park. Spend the morning exploring the lush greenery and spotting unique flora and fauna. Don't miss the Dudhsagar Waterfalls, the highest waterfall in Goa, located within the park. Afterward, visit the nearby Tambdi Surla Temple, a 12th-century Shiva temple known for its intricate carvings. In the evening, relax and enjoy a sunset cruise along the Mandovi River.

  • Bhagwan Mahavir Wildlife Sanctuary and Mollem National Park: ₹100 per person, 4-5 hours
  • Dudhsagar Waterfalls: ₹400 per person (Jeep safari), 2-3 hours
  • Tambdi Surla Temple: Free, 1-2 hours
  • Sunset cruise: ₹500-₹1000 per person, 2-3 hours
Wednesday, October 25: Water Fun

Spend your last day in Goa enjoying the thrilling water slides and rides at the Splashdown Waterpark. Cool off in the pools, relax on the lazy river, and have endless fun with your family. In the afternoon, visit the Naval Aviation Museum, where you can explore the history of Indian naval aviation through aircraft exhibits and simulations. End your day with a leisurely sunset picnic at Dona Paula View Point, overlooking the Arabian Sea.

  • Splashdown Waterpark: ₹500-₹1000 per person, 4-5 hours
  • Naval Aviation Museum: ₹20 per person, 2-3 hours
  • Dona Paula View Point: Free, 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, head to the peaceful Divar Island. Take a ferry ride and explore the island's scenic beauty, ancient churches, and traditional Goan villages. Another local favorite is the Arpora Saturday Night Market, where you can find a variety of stalls selling handicrafts, clothes, and delicious street food. Don't miss the opportunity to try Goan cuisine, known for its flavorful seafood dishes like prawn curry and fish fry.
